On Wed, 26 Nov 2025 14:45:09 +0800, Shengjiu Wang wrote:
memset_io() writes memory byte by byte with __raw_writeb() on the arm
platform if the size is word. but XCVR data RAM memory can't be accessed
with byte address, so with memset_io() the channel status control memory
is not really cleared, use writel_relaxed() instead.
